Mathématiques

Question

Bonjour, pourriez vous m'aider sur cet exo de programmation sur python svp
énoncé: A l'aide d'une boucle for, écrire une fonction sigma qui entrée reçoit la variable entière n et qui en sortie calcule et affiche la somme des carrés des n premiers nombres entiers naturels.
Par exemple, sigma(6) calcule 1² + 2² + 3² + 4² + 5² + 6² et affiche donc : 91.

1 Réponse

  • Hello !

    voici le programme (S est la somme) :

    a = int(input())

    b = 1

    S = 0

    for loop in range(a) :

    S = S + b**2

    b = b + 1

    print(S)

    n'oublie pas l'indentation après la boucle ;-)

Autres questions